Authorities have actually recovered 41 bodies after an airplane crash in Washington DC.
Sixty-seven individuals were killed when an American Airlines jet and a military helicopter clashed mid-air on Wednesday night. So far, 28 bodies have been recognized.
Both aircraft crashed into the Potomac River after the accident. Some 300 workers were sent to the scene, but the rescue soon developed into a healing mission as officials said there were no survivors.

It indicates a single controller was handling both aircraft and helicopter traffic in the area when the 2 aircraft clashed.
It is allowable - however not ideal - for one controller to do both jobs, NBC News reported.
The American Airlines jet was bring 60 travelers and four crew when it crashed with the Black Hawk helicopter, bring 3 soldiers, quickly before 9pm local time on Wednesday.
Flight 5342 was preparing to arrive at runway 33 at the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port when it clashed with the helicopter in among the most firmly controlled airspaces worldwide.

A male whose better half was on the flight has recalled how he saw emergency situation services "speeding past" as he was waiting at the airport to pick her up.
Hamaad Raza informed NBC News his better half of 2 years, Asra, had "texted me [and] stated, 'We're landing in 20 minutes'".
" I was waiting and I started seeing a bunch of EMS automobiles speeding past me ... way too many, [more] than normal and my texts weren't going through."

Donald Trump has actually linked a variety drive at the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) under previous federal governments to the crash.
It has considering that been said there is no proof to support the US president's claim.
Speaking at the White House on Thursday, Mr Trump suggested the diversity efforts had actually made flight less safe.
At a White House press briefing on Friday, press secretary Karoline Leavitt said Mr Trump had actually signed a memorandum directing an instant evaluation of FAA hiring decisions made throughout the previous administration.
While Mr Trump's claim appears to have been unmasked, there are concerns over staffing at Reagan Washington National Airport.
NBC News reported staffing in the air traffic control tower was "not typical", according to a preliminary FAA report.
The tower normally has a controller who focuses specifically on helicopter traffic - however at the time of the crash, a source said, one controller was managing both plane and wiki.team-glisto.com helicopter activity.
The FAA, which controls air traffic control along with certification of workers and aircraft, is without an irreversible administrator. Its previous employer Michael Whitaker stepped down on 20 January - the day of Mr Trump's inauguration.

At his briefing, Mr Trump blamed previous president Joe Biden for lowering requirements for air traffic controllers.
" We have to have our most intelligent people," he stated. "They need to be naturally talented geniuses."
Mr Trump added: "The FAA is actively recruiting employees who suffer serious intellectual specials needs, psychiatric issues, and other mental and physical conditions under a variety and inclusion hiring initiative spelled out on the firm's website."
The American Association of People with Disabilities reacted to these claims, stating in a declaration on X: "FAA staff members with specials needs did not trigger [the] awful airplane crash.
" The investigation into the crash is still continuous. It is very unsuitable for the president to use this tragedy to press an anti-diversity hiring program. Doing so makes all Americans less safe."
